Skip to main content

Avant de commencer

Intercom est bien plus qu’une simple fenêtre de chat. C’est une plateforme de support client qui vous permet de :
  • Afficher un widget de chat dans votre application afin que les utilisateurs puissent poser des questions instantanément.
  • Répondre depuis une console centralisée où toute votre équipe support travaille.
  • Automatiser des messages, envoyer des visites guidées et même intégrer d’autres canaux comme l’e-mail, WhatsApp ou Slack.
Lorsque vous connectez Intercom à votre application, vous donnez à vos utilisateurs la possibilité d’obtenir de l’aide exactement au moment où ils en ont besoin, sans quitter l’écran. Mais contrairement à Stripe ou SendGrid, cette intégration ne consiste pas seulement à coller une clé. En tant qu’administrateur, vous configurez l’App ID dans le CMS, puis un développeur doit insérer un petit extrait de code dans le frontend de votre application. C’est ce qui fait réellement apparaître le chat pour les utilisateurs.

Étape 1 : Ouvrir le CMS et aller sur Intercom

Connectez-vous à votre CMS ici : allez dans le CMS.
Dans le menu de gauche, cliquez sur Integrations, puis sélectionnez Intercom.
Un panneau s’affichera en demandant une valeur appelée app_id. Il s’agit de l’identifiant unique de votre projet Intercom, et c’est ce qui relie votre application à votre compte Intercom.

Étape 2 : Trouver votre App ID dans Intercom

Pour récupérer votre App ID :
  1. Connectez-vous à Intercom.
  2. Allez dans Settings > Messenger > Install.
  3. Vous y verrez un extrait de code (snippet).
La valeur dont vous avez besoin est celle de app_id (remplacez "YOUR_APP_ID" par votre App ID Intercom réel).

Étape 3 : Ajouter l’App ID dans le CMS

De retour dans le CMS, dans la section Intercom :
  1. Cliquez sur Add API Key.
  2. Laissez le nom de clé sur app_id.
  3. Collez votre App ID Intercom dans Key Value.
  4. Marquez-le comme Active et enregistrez les modifications.
Votre application « sait » maintenant à quel compte Intercom elle doit se connecter.

Étape 4 : Partager l’extrait de code avec votre développeur

C’est ici que votre développeur intervient. Ajouter l’App ID dans le CMS ne fera pas apparaître le chat à lui seul. L’extrait de code vu dans Intercom doit être inséré dans le frontend de votre application. Où l’ajouter ?
  • Dans une application React, votre développeur le placera généralement dans le fichier de layout principal.
  • Sur un site statique, il peut être ajouté dans le <head> ou juste avant la balise de fermeture </body>.
Pourquoi un développeur ? Parce que l’extrait peut aussi être personnalisé avec les données de vos utilisateurs (nom, e-mail, date d’inscription). Ainsi, lorsqu’un utilisateur ouvre le chat, votre équipe support sait déjà à qui elle parle, ce qui rend les échanges plus rapides et plus personnalisés.

Étape 5 : Tester le chat

Une fois que votre développeur a ajouté le code :
  1. Connectez-vous à votre application en tant qu’utilisateur normal.
  2. Vous devriez voir l’icône Intercom en bas à droite.
  3. Ouvrez-la et envoyez un message de test.
  4. Votre équipe support doit voir ce message immédiatement dans la console Intercom.

Erreurs fréquentes à éviter

  • Oublier d’activer l’App ID dans le CMS → même si le code est installé, sans App ID actif le chat ne se connectera pas.
  • Utiliser le mauvais App ID → chaque projet Intercom a son propre identifiant ; assurez-vous de copier le bon.
  • Ne pas tester avec un vrai utilisateur → testez toujours en tant qu’utilisateur standard, pas uniquement en tant qu’administrateur.
  • Ne pas transmettre l’extrait à votre développeur → rappelez-vous : les deux étapes sont obligatoires, CMS + code frontend.

Intercom comme nouveau point d’accueil

Avec Intercom connecté, votre application devient plus qu’un simple logiciel. C’est un espace où les utilisateurs savent qu’ils peuvent vous joindre instantanément. Cela renforce la confiance, maintient l’engagement et donne à votre équipe support une visibilité en temps réel sur ce qui se passe. Donc : configurez votre App ID, transmettez l’extrait à votre développeur et vérifiez que le chat s’affiche. Une fois fait, vous avez débloqué un canal de communication direct dans votre application.